Work: C800universalk9mzspa1583m9binReview: Cisco IOS 15.8(3)M9 (c800universalk9mz.SPA.158-3.M9.bin)Verdict: A mature, stable, and highly recommended "Long Lived" release for the Cisco 800 series. It is arguably the most reliable choice for branch offices and remote workers still utilizing this hardware generation before the End-of-Life (EOL) transition.
